Transaction faf37ed369021f69c58d646585900dbdb5ab9317c479e8564f4ea31a35156257
2 Input
1 Outputs
- faf37ed369021f69c58d646585900dbdb5ab9317c479e8564f4ea31a35156257:0
value 434976
address 1PW5zEspLMUWPXs9fF9s7v7GyyDAaiUzm3